This immaculately presented ground floor apartment is perfect for beach lovers and walkers alike, just yards from the coastal footpath and a five minute walk from Maenporth cove.

Part of a small, prestigious development of just nine apartments with private parking right outside, Opie's Toy has a sheltered balcony which enjoys views over clifftop fields out to the sea.

Maenporth cove has a sandy beach with rock pools to explore as the tide drops back, a traditional beach cafe and a popular beachside restaurant. The coastal footpath wends its way along the cliffs to thriving Falmouth in one direction and the Helford River valley in the other, where gorgeous subtropical gardens at Glendurgan and Trebah just beg to be explored.

Opie's Toy is a delight; as soon as the front door is opened the quality is apparent, with oak flooring, modern furnishings and under-floor heating throughout the spacious apartment.

The large open plan living-room has contemporary dining furniture, comfortable sofas and a Smart television. The pebble-effect wall-mounted fire evokes images of the coast and the kitchen-area, fitted with high specification appliances, glossy white units and dark granite work surfaces, is fully equipped. Floor to ceiling windows line the front wall and a door leads out to the balcony. The main bedroom has its own shower-room and the second bedroom can be made up with either twin beds or a super-king size double bed.

There is plenty of activity in nearby Falmouth with its bustling marinas, watersport tuition and intriguing selection of shops, restaurants and bars, while the stunning coastal scenery and renowned surfing beaches of the north coast are just half an hour away. This is a perfect apartment for families, with little children catered for and plenty of opportunities for sandcastle building down at the beach. Older children can learn to kayak or paddleboard at nearby Swanpool beach, and kayaking is also available at Maenporth beach.
